For the Synthesis of tetramic acid component of dihydromaltophilin 12 and maltophilin 13, stereoselective syntheses of tetramic acid - contained phosphonates 123a and 123b were accomplished. The key features of the scheme include the regioselective aminolysis of 2,3-epoxy alcohols 76a and 76b, and stereoselective Dieckmann cyclization to afford tetramic acids. Aminolysis of 2,3-epoxy alcohols 76a and 76b proceeded smoothly with titanium cation - mediated ring opening. Dieckmann cyclization of amides 122a and 122b was achieved using tetrabutylammonium fluoride. A synthetic modification of lovastatin 38 to simvastatin 42 was examined. Methylation of butyrate group in lovastatin 38 was unsuccessful. Hydrolysis of lovastatin 38 to diol 133 could be achieved with lithium hydroxide, but the reaction proceeded inefficiently in terms of chemical yield and reaction time. Diol 133 was converted into a simvastatin analogue, ester 136 via acetonide 134.
